Understanding Fair Play Standards
Online gaming thrives on a foundation of fair play and mutual respect. Before diving into any game, whether competitive or casual, players need to understand the core principles that keep the community healthy. Fair play means respecting other players, following the game’s rules, and refusing to exploit glitches or use unauthorized software. When everyone commits to honest gameplay, the experience becomes enjoyable for all participants. Cheating destroys the competitive spirit and ruins experiences for legitimate players. This includes aimbots, wallhacks, lag switches, and account manipulation. Games publish their terms of service specifically to outline what constitutes cheating. Violating these rules typically results in permanent bans, which can impact your gaming reputation across multiple platforms.
Protecting Your Personal Information
Your security matters as much as the gameplay itself. Never share your login credentials with anyone, even friends. Use unique, strong passwords for gaming accounts and enable two-factor authentication whenever available. Phishing scams targeting gamers are increasingly common, so verify official communications directly through the game’s legitimate website or app.

Respecting Community Guidelines
Every gaming platform has a code of conduct designed to create welcoming spaces. Harassment, hate speech, and toxic behavior violate these standards and harm other players. This includes offensive language, discrimination, and bullying. Reporting systems exist for a reason—use them when you encounter violations.
- Maintain respectful communication in chat and voice channels
- Avoid spamming or flooding channels with repetitive messages
- Don’t impersonate other players or staff members
- Keep conversations appropriate and free from offensive content
- Report rule violations promptly to moderators
